This week on the pod, I’m sitting down with my good friend Dr. Tannetje Crocker for a really important conversation about something every pet owner wonders at some point — why is vet care so expensive?We’re breaking down everything from why you shouldn’t bring emergencies to your general practice vet, to what makes ER and specialty practices cost more, to how we as veterinarians think about “value” when it comes to your pet’s care. We even touch on the hard stuff — like financial euthanasia decisions — and how you can plan ahead for your dog’s breed, set realistic expectations, and protect yourself with pet insurance.Do you have a question or inquiry for me?
